Covid-19: No deaths, 48 cases reported in 24 hrs

04:06 PM, 08 Apr 2022 Friday

Bangladesh reported zero COVID-19 deaths and 48 cases in the last 24 hours. With this, the total fatalities are 29,123 and infections rose to 19,51,995. The Directorate General of Health Services said this in a press release on Friday. As many as 6,230 samples were collected and 6,238 ones tested in the past day...
